Reuters reported citing officials yesterday (10th) in local time yesterday when it said the US President Donald Trump rejected a South Korean proposal to raise at least 13 percent in relation to a labor-sharing agreement.
Reuters said former US officials said there was little hope for a new agreement in the near future.
Earlier this month, it was known earlier that the ROK-US Defense Cost Contribution Agreement had reached an opinion on the working level, but the US side is experiencing last-minute pains by stating that it is "still negotiating."
There have been observations that the Trump presidential variable, which has been demanding a significant increase, has been in operation at the end of the negotiations that seemed to be entering a tentative conclusion.
